## Configuration

Chipline reads timing-chip pings from trackside mats and posts splits to the results board. Set `READER_PORT` (default 7070) and `MAT_COUNT` to match the course layout — reviewers, please sanity-check that against `course.yml`. Debounce window is `PING_DEBOUNCE_MS`, default 250. The reader signs each split with a shared secret, defined on the very next line.

vault entry, yahif-yajep: COURIER_KEY29=b802bdf8034096b65a51c6ba5abe2

## Deploying the Gatewick Proctor Queue

Deploys are pretty painless: push to main, wait for the pipeline, then watch the queue drain dashboard for five minutes. If candidates pile up mid-exam, roll back first and ask questions later — the queue replays safely. Everything the workers care about lives in one config block, shown here for reference.

settings of bafof-yagef:
JOROX_PIN=8740
JOROX_TENANT=pelox
JOROX_METRICS_HOST=metrics.jorox.qorvelworks.internal
JOROX_SEAL=seal_c78f63c1
JOROX_STANDBY_TEAM=norax

Subject: Potential Acquisition of Brightholm Systems

Team,

As sales leads, you should be aware that we are in early-stage discussions to acquire Brightholm Systems, a regional supplier of warehouse automation tools. Their Quillback platform would complement our Ferndale logistics suite and close a persistent gap in mid-market coverage. Due diligence begins next month; please treat all customer inquiries on this topic as speculation and route them to corporate communications. The confidential outline of our intended plan follows below.

internal memo for fajog-yagaf: Gross margin on Ulaael came in at 20 percent against a plan of 10 percent. Only 9 of the 80 pilot accounts renewed Ulaael, so a churn review is set for July 1.

Query planner regression in Kestrelbase 4.2: joins on partitioned tables now fall back to sequential scans when the stats sampler is stale. Reviewer note: the fix in planner/cost_est.go restores the index-path heuristic but changes plan hashes, so expect golden-file churn. Verify against the nightly plan corpus before approving. The affected build is identified below.

pipeline stamp: htk9_ce63042d9